#d4f9cd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#d4f9cd is composed of 83.1% red, 97.6% green and 80.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 14.9% cyan, 0% magenta, 17.7% yellow and 2.4% black. It has a hue angle of 110.5 degrees, a saturation of 78.6% and a lightness of 89%. #d4f9cd color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#a9f39b. Closest websafe color is: #ccffcc.

Shades and Tints of #d4f9cd
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010300 is the darkest color, while #f2fdf0 is the lightest one.
